make 'got update' bump the base commit ID of unchanged files

This change makes it actually possible to get around commit-time out-of-dateness by running 'got update'. The test added with this commit shows that our out-of-dateness check is currently too simplistic; an update is required between any two commit operations! It would be better to allow commits to proceed until a situation arises where file content must be merged.

implement spawning an editor to collect a commit message

bails on empty messages, trims leading and trailing newlines this currently disables the unveil in the commit process because it's not compatible with spawning the editor also prevent commits when there are no changes
